Oregano Oil: Benefits and Precautions
-
Source & Active Compounds: Extracted from Origanum vulgare, oregano oil contains carvacrol and thymol, which give it strong antimicrobial properties.
-
Digestive Support: Studies suggest it can help combat intestinal parasites (like giardia and pinworms), potentially improving gut health and nutrient absorption.
-
Urinary Tract Support: Its antimicrobial action may inhibit harmful bacteria in the urinary system, supporting prevention of infections.
-
Safety & Usage: Highly concentrated, oregano oil can cause irritation if not diluted. Overuse or improper application may lead to side effects.
-
Professional Guidance: Always consult a healthcare provider before adding oregano oil to your routine, especially if you have medical conditions or take medications.
Bottom Line: When used responsibly, oregano oil is a potent natural remedy with antimicrobial benefits, supporting both digestive and urinary health.
